Tigers can swim for three miles without resting. They have also swam from island to island. Their roar
can also be heard from up to two miles away, and sometimes farther. Many people do not know some
of the amazing facts about tigers.
Tigers are the biggest member of the cat family, with lions coming in at a close second. Their paw
pads are very sensitive and are easily damaged, which prevents them from following prey that may
wonder on such things as rocks that are hot. Another interesting fact about the tiger is that there are no
white tigers left in the wild, only in captivity. On top of that, all of the white tigers in captivity came
from the same female, which was caught in 1952. White tigers are not true albinos because they lack
pink eyes; theirs are blue. Tigers and lions have actually mated in captivity. The offspring of a male
tiger and a female lion is called a Tigon, and offspring of a male lion and a female tiger is called a
Liger.
Tigers are getting more and more scarce. In the world today, there are about 12 Javan tigers still alive,
and less than 110 Siberian tigers. Their only needs in life are water, food, and shade, so this is
definitely not the cause of their near extinction. The number of tigers in the world is decreasing
because of hunters that like the fur. Tigers are rarely shot for attacking humans, for they

Chlamydia Is Among The Smallest Organisms Essay
Chlamydia is among the smallest organisms. Under a microscope, they are seen as obligate
intracellular parasites. One characteristic of Chlamydia is that they could not produce their own
energy which makes them completely dependent on the energy of their hosts (Centers for Disease
Control and Prevention, 2001).
Chlamydia undergoes two stages in its development, namely the elementary bodies and the reticulate
bodies. In its elementary stage, this organism meets its host and is taken up by phagocytosis which
thwarts the process of combination of the lysosome and phagosome. This microscopic event normally
kills pathogens. Once the formation of phagolysosome is stopped, the bacteria produce glycogen and
it then changes into the reticulate body. Reticulate bodies attain their energy by sending forth straw
like structures into the cell cytoplasm of their host. These bodies then are divided by binary fission. It
is estimated that for each phagolysosome about 100 1000 reticulate bodies are produced (Chlamydia
Trachomatis, n.d.).
Causes
Chlamydia infection is particularly caused by the bacteria known as Chlamydia trachomatis which in
turn causes cervicitis and bartholinitis in women and urethritis in men. It also causes extragenital
infections which include rectal and oropharyngeal infections (World Health Organization, 2016). As a
form of sexually transmitted infection, an individual may get infected through sexual contact vaginal,
anal, or oral sex. A person is more likely

Cardiac Arrest Analysis
Approximately three hundred thousand cardiac arrests occur annually in the United States, making it
one of the leading causes of death nationally (1). Pulseless electrical activity (PEA) is one of the most
common forms of cardiac arrest and is generally associated with poor patient outcomes. It has been
widely theorized that a focused cardiac ultrasound exam (FoCUS) can play both a diagnostic and a
prognostic role during PEA cardiac arrest; however, it has not been adequately studied to date. This
paper explores the theory and current evidence supporting the utilization of a FoCUS exam during
cardiac arrest presenting with PEA in order to recognize its potential role in resuscitative guidelines.
